文本文档压缩技术有哪些

文本文档压缩技术有哪些

作者:Elara发布时间:2025-12-30阅读时长:0 分钟阅读次数:40

用户关注问题

Q
有哪些常用的文本文档压缩算法?

我想知道在文本文档压缩中常用的算法有哪些?它们有什么特点?

A

常见的文本文档压缩算法介绍

常用的文本文档压缩算法包括Huffman编码、LZ77、LZ78以及LZW等。Huffman编码通过构建最优前缀码实现无损压缩,适合文本字符频率差异大时使用。LZ77和LZ78属于字典压缩算法,利用文本中重复的内容进行替换,从而减小文件大小。LZW是基于LZ78改进的算法,压缩效率较高,广泛应用于GIF等格式。

Q
如何选择合适的文本文档压缩技术?

面对多种压缩技术,我该如何根据需求挑选最适合我的文本文档压缩方法?

A

选择文本文档压缩技术的建议

选择文本文档压缩技术时,需要综合考虑压缩率、压缩速度、解压速度以及应用环境。若对压缩率要求较高,可以选择基于字典的算法如LZ系列。关注压缩和解压速度的话,Huffman编码因其简单性较快。还要根据是否需要无损压缩来决定,一般文本文件都采用无损压缩技术。结合实际需求综合评估后,选择最合适的方案。

Q
文本文档压缩后会影响文件内容的质量吗?

压缩文本文档后,内容会不会被破坏或者丢失?

A

文本文档压缩的内容完整性

文本文档压缩大多采用无损压缩技术,这意味着压缩和解压过程不会丢失任何信息,文件内容保持完整。用户解压后可以获取与原始文本文档完全相同的文件。不建议使用有损压缩技术处理重要文本文件,因为那样会导致数据损失和内容变化。